History in the making: Sasha Banks to face Charlotte in a Hell in a Cell match

When Sasha Banks and Charlotte main evented Raw last week, (in a great match by the way), I thought there was no way they could top that. Well, in the span of a week they proved me wrong. Sasha started off Monday Night Raw tonight to talk about her title win. After all of the “you deserve it” chants died down, Sasha looked to make a statement for the future of the women’s division.

And what a statement it was.

The champion challenged Charlotte to a match at the Hell in a Cell PPV on Oct. 30 in the her home town of Boston, Massachusetts. She didn’t just ask for any normal match though. Sasha challenged “The Queen” to a match INSIDE the demonic Hell in a Cell structure. After some shenanigans with Lana and Rusev, Charlotte agreed to the match.

Talk about a game-changer. This will be the first time two women will compete in this type of match in WWE history (possibly professional wrestling history as well). 2016 has once again been an awesome year for women’s wrestling, with Sasha and Charlotte at the forefront. There are a lot of possibilities that can happen in this match. Will they fight outside the cell? Will they go on top of it? While I don’t expect blood to be drawn, I’m sure there will be a lot of carnage involved.
